Airbnb stresses its positive impact on Jalisco economy

While often criticized for contributing to gentrification and rising property and rental costs, Airbnb’s presence in Jalisco is proving to have significant economic benefits for the region. 

Screen Shot 2025 10 23 at 18.58.02Recent data released by the company reveals that, in 2024 alone, Airbnb activities generated over 17 billion pesos (US$920 million) for the state, underscoring its role as a key player in Jalisco’s economic growth.

The platform insists that its influence stretches far beyond just the hosts and guests involved in bookings. In Jalisco, Airbnb claims to help sustain more than 36,000 jobs and contribute over 4.4 billion pesos (US$238 million) in labor income. This economic boost has primarily benefitted micro and small businesses, particularly those in food services, transportation and local retail, Airbnb says.
